<div dir="ltr"><div>Hi Andrew,</div><div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Thu, 4 Mar 2021 at 08:59, Andrew C Aitchison <<a href="mailto:andrew@aitchison.me.uk" target="_blank">andrew@aitchison.me.uk</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-style:solid;padding-left:1ex;border-left-color:rgb(204,204,204)" dir="auto">On Thu, 4 Mar 2021, Javier Jimenez Shaw wrote:<br>
<br>
> (using a docker image to convert any of those removed formats if you find a<br>
> file at the bottom of you cellar in the far future is a great alternative.<br>
<br>
I don't have a lot of confidence in being able to run an old docker image<br>
in the far future, especially if I don't have an x86 machine to run it on.<br>
<br>
<a href="https://medium.com/nttlabs/buildx-multiarch-2c6c2df00ca2" rel="noreferrer" target="_blank">https://medium.com/nttlabs/buildx-multiarch-2c6c2df00ca2</a><br>
suggests that docker images should be built "multi-arch"<br>
so that they run on x86 and the new ARM-based Apple Macs. </blockquote><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-style:solid;padding-left:1ex;border-left-color:rgb(204,204,204)" dir="auto"> </blockquote><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-style:solid;padding-left:1ex;border-left-color:rgb(204,204,204)" dir="auto">
Who is going to rebuild and host the current GDAL docker like this?</blockquote><div dir="auto"><br></div><div dir="auto">Your question comes across as entitled — the answer is: whoever cares enough to either do the work or pay someone to do it.</div><div dir="auto"><br></div><div dir="auto">The source code is there, the release archives are staying, and it will be possible to build an old release in the future which can read & convert a file they find. Docker images provide a great <b>shortcut</b>, which means if you find a file you can trivially convert it <i>without</i> building GDAL. I'm sure eventually GDAL will produce multi-arch docker images, but that shouldn't be a prerequisite for this deprecation/removal.</div><div dir="auto"><br></div><div dir="auto">Debian 1.1 386 floppy disk images from 1996 are still available, and if you have a m68000, sparc, a s390 or something else long-gone you can easily find historic Linux release images with compilers which will happily run. x86 will not disappear quickly, today's Linux kernel releases continue to support 486s and they were discontinued over 13 years ago. GDALs source code is also <a href="https://archiveprogram.github.com/">held in the Arctic Code Vault and other archival libraries</a> — it's not going to disappear any time soon.</div><div dir="auto"><br></div><div>Regards, </div><div><br></div><div>Rob :)</div><div dir="auto"><br></div></div></div>
</div>